| primary centre of ossification | This is the first site where bone begins to form in the shaft of a long bone or in the body of an irregular bone. Synonym: punctum ossificationis primarium, primary point of ossification. (05 Mar 2000) |
|---|---|
| health centre | An institution or group of institutions providing all types of medical care and preventive services to a population. (05 Mar 2000) |
| satiety centre | A term referring to the region of the ventromedial nucleus in the hypothalamus; destruction of this small region in the rat leads to continuous eating and extreme obesity. (05 Mar 2000) |
| secondary centre of ossification | This is the centre of bone formation appearing later than the punctum ossificationis primarium, usually in epiphysis. Synonym: punctum ossificationis secundarium, secondary point of ossification. (05 Mar 2000) |
| semioval centre | The great mass of white matter composing the interior of the cerebral hemisphere; the name refers to the general shape of this white core in horizontal sections of the hemisphere. Synonym: centrum medullare, centrum ovale, medullary centre, semioval centre, Vicq d'Azyr's centrum semiovale, Vieussens' centrum. (05 Mar 2000) |
| sensory speech centre | The region of the cerebral cortex thought to be essential for understanding and formulating coherent, propositional speech; it encompasses a large region of the parietal and temporal lobes near the lateral sulcus of the left cerebral hemisphere; corresponding approximately to Brodmann's areas 40, 39, and 22. Synonym: sensory speech centre, Wernicke's area, Wernicke's field, Wernicke's region, Wernicke's zone. (05 Mar 2000) |
| sphenotic centre | One of the paired centre's of ossification of the sphenoid bone. (05 Mar 2000) |

| dentary centre | A specific ossification centre of the mandible that gives rise to the lower border of its outer plate. (05 Mar 2000) |
| diaphysial centre | Primary centre of ossification in the shaft of a long bone. (05 Mar 2000) |
| inspiratory centre | The region of the medulla oblongata that is electrically active during inspiration and where electrical stimulation produces sustained inspiration. (05 Mar 2000) |

| ossific centre | The site of earliest bone formation via accumulation of osteoblasts within connective tissue (membranous ossification) or of earliest destruction of cartilage prior to onset of ossification (endochondral ossification). Synonym: punctum ossificationis, ossific centre, point of ossification. (05 Mar 2000) |
